Part of the safety requirements for DFCS is to have the previous school records when enrolling a child in custody in a new school. DFCS is aware that most schools are closed, and some are providing online classes for students. WebMeeting within 30 days of the child’s enrollment in a new school. The BID Form shall be used to document the ES meeting. Check on the top of the form the box for Educational Services meeting. For an ES meeting the following questions in Section II do not need to be completed: 4, 12, 13, 14, and 15. Section III is also not completed for an ES ...
